Output 4088e9c5e25275ac9e534c62059f212239b7c9d6e15e1f8dd9418751f8580cf0:0

value
612511274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c93988bd64d9b84efb703a9e1aed7a0efad9e9 OP_EQUAL
address
3N6HffMoLsZNWj1AeyosrKG4qMWzJPbEfR
transaction
4088e9c5e25275ac9e534c62059f212239b7c9d6e15e1f8dd9418751f8580cf0